Abstract
In this paper, an approach based on the objective speckles field to measure the elastic modulus of solid material with three-points bending method is presented. The speckle images of the loading force rod under different loading are recorded and performed Fast Fourier Transformation (FFT), the deflection of the specimen can be obtained. The Young's modulus of the specimen calculated agrees well with that of stretch approach. The approach presented in this paper has advantage of simplicity, noncontact and high accuracy.
